A woman and her daughter-in-law have died of suspected food poisoning after eating a meal containing garden egg.
The two residents of Mile 3 Nkwen died after consuming what many sources confirmed was garden egg over the weekend.
Reports say they were among many members of the same family admitted at a health facility after eating the food.
The family head is said to have regained consciousness hours after being admitted at the hospital, only to realise that his wife and daughter-in-law had died.
The exact cause of the deaths is yet to be ascertained. It is suspected that the family might have been poisoned by external forces.
